Create new solutions to old problemswith the power of mentoring! Mentoring is an extraordinarily powerful way of getting top performance from every employee.It’s one of the hottest management techniques used in business today, and every managerserious about developing talented employees and implementing change in his or her organizationneeds to master it. Manager’s Guide to Mentoring is a detailed overview covering Types of mentors, from professional to corporate to informal Mentoring across traditional cultural and gender boundaries Developing a mentoring program within your organization Manager’s Guide to Mentoring provides all the skills for using one of today’s most innovativemanagement techniques to drive positive change in your company.
